Understanding Parkinson's Disease

Parkinson's Disease is a progressive neurological condition that impacts movement and can take a real toll on daily life. It develops when the brain's dopamine-producing nerve cells — which help regulate movement, start to break down over time. Doctors haven't pinpointed one exact cause, but a mix of genetic and environmental factors is thought to play a role. Symptoms typically appear gradually and look different from person to person. Some of the most common signs include:

Shaking or Trembling: Often beginning in one limb, most commonly the hand or fingers.

Movement Slowdown: Everyday tasks may start to take longer and feel more difficult as movement slows.

Rigidity: Stiffness can develop in any part of the body, limiting range of motion and sometimes causing discomfort.

Stability and Alignment Issues: A stooped posture or difficulty maintaining balance can develop as the condition progresses.

Diminished Reflexive Actions: Everyday unconscious actions like blinking, smiling, or swinging your arms while walking may become less frequent.

Vocal Pattern Shifts: Speech may become softer, faster, slurred, or hesitant, and can sound more flat or monotone than before.

Fine Motor Script Difficulty: Writing may become more difficult, often appearing smaller and more cramped than usual.

These symptoms tend to progress over time, though the rate varies widely from one person to the next. While there's currently no cure for Parkinson's, a range of treatment options are available to help manage symptoms and support quality of life.
